Recent scientific endeavors have highlighted the involvement of various peptides in ovarian physiology and pathology. For instance, Vasoactive Intestinal Peptide (VIP) has been a subject of considerable interest. Studies have shown that VIP deficiency can promote premature reproductive aging and lead to infertility by impacting ovarian follicular development. Conversely, an increased VIP concentration in follicular fluids has been observed in patients with pol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S), suggesting a potential link between VIP levels and this common endocrine disorder. The presence of Vasoactive Intestinal Peptide and Its Receptors in Human Ovarian Cortical Follicles further underscores its functional significance in the ovary. Furthermore, Vasoactive Intestinal Peptide has been shown to enhance aromatase activity in the ovary, a key enzyme in estrogen synthesis.

Beyond VIP, other peptides are demonstrating promise in ovarian health. Specific endogenous tryptic peptides have been detected that differentiate ovarian cancer from normal tissues. Moreover, cluster-enhanced nanopore sensing of ovarian cancer marker peptides is being developed for improved detection. Promisingly, a peptide originally being tested for atherosclerosis has demonstrated significant inhibition of ovarian cancer tumor growth in both cell lines and animal models. This has led to the investigation of peptides as a strategy for targeting primary and metastatic ovarian cancer.
